Centre sanctions ₹1554.99 crore to five states hit by floods, landslides, cyclones

A committee headed by Union Home Minister Amit Shah has approved ₹1554.99 crore of additional central assistance under the National Disaster Response Fund (NDRF) to five states affected by floods, flash floods, landslides and cyclonic storms during 2024. Minister orders probe into tiger death in Shivamogga in Karnataka

Environment Minister Eshwar Khandre has ordered a probe into the death of a tiger in the backwaters of Ambaligola reservoir in Shivamogga district of Karnataka.
